if you stick a scope to the intake adjacent the heads and don't hear anything strange- like tapping or screeching- I wouldn't swap the tappets.. Unless your looking to truly bump that engine up with a new performance cam, and the existing cam doesn't have excessive wear from debris or a funky tappet bearing, I'd leave it alone too.. I would inspect the rods for wear and make sure they aren't clogged with anything like sludge or such; as well as make sure they aren't at all bent.. other than that, I would leave well enough alone..
this is coming from someone who just had to swap out a single bad tappet a few weeks ago (I did eight, but only one was bad).. as aggravating as that was, I still wouldn't swap them out preemptively..
